]> git.ipfire.org Git - thirdparty/bugzilla.git/commitdiff
Bug 768870: The "Un-forget the search" link has no token
authorFrédéric Buclin <LpSolit@gmail.com>
Wed, 27 Jun 2012 16:12:10 +0000 (18:12 +0200)
committerFrédéric Buclin <LpSolit@gmail.com>
Wed, 27 Jun 2012 16:12:10 +0000 (18:12 +0200)
r=glob a=LpSolit

buglist.cgi

index fcd2689596d23b08717eb955203c6b58835be88e..1029f0fe74365c7556db5902c41821cbae087bff 100755 (executable)
@@ -452,7 +452,9 @@ if ($cmdtype eq "dorem") {
         # Generate and return the UI (HTML page) from the appropriate template.
         $vars->{'message'} = "buglist_query_gone";
         $vars->{'namedcmd'} = $qname;
-        $vars->{'url'} = "buglist.cgi?newquery=" . url_quote($buffer) . "&cmdtype=doit&remtype=asnamed&newqueryname=" . url_quote($qname);
+        $vars->{'url'} = "buglist.cgi?newquery=" . url_quote($buffer)
+                         . "&cmdtype=doit&remtype=asnamed&newqueryname=" . url_quote($qname)
+                         . "&token=" . url_quote(issue_hash_token(['savedsearch']));
         $template->process("global/message.html.tmpl", $vars)
           || ThrowTemplateError($template->error());
         exit;